Job Description :
Demonstrated experience leading development or engineering teams towards speed, predictability and quality.
Demonstrated experience in designing data architecture solutions to address design problems or requirements.
Demonstrated experience in delivering high quality work within estimated time constraints, ensuring data architecture remains fast, flexible, and serves the needs of the end user.
Strong in RESTful API integrations (e.g. Stripe, Cloudinary, Pusher
Demonstrated experience in implementing efficient and scalable test-driven development components.
Strong in personal organization and attention to detail.
Strong in translating business requirements to manageable projects/tasks for the Development Team.
Proficient understanding of code versioning tools, such as Git.
Proficient understanding of single page web app development using AngularJS, React, Polymer or equivalent.
Proficient understanding of continuous deployment processes.


Experience Requirements

5+ years developing with web app frameworks, such as Ruby on Rails, Microsoft MVC or Python Django.
3+ years managing a team of developers or software engineers.
Bachelor''s Degree in Computer Science, Engineering or related fields (or equivalent
             

Similar Jobs you may be interested in ..